Stephen Ahorlu

Stephen Ahorlu ( born September 5, 1988 in Kpandu ) is a Ghanaian football goalkeeper.

Ahorlu played since youth in his home for Heart of Lions. From 2007 to 2010 he played in the men's team in the Ghana Premier League. With the Football World Cup 2010 in South Africa, he was a member of the Ghanaian squad as a second goalie, but was not used. In summer 2010, he moved to Israel Hapoel Ashkelon. After just one season in Israel Ahorlu returned in the summer of 2011 and returned to Ghana, where he signed in September for Medeama SC. In February 2012 he left Medeama SC and replaced Philemon McCarthy at Wassaman United.
